PF00439Bromodomain (Bromodomain)BromodomainBromodomains are 110 amino acid long domains, that are found in many chromatin associated proteins. Bromodomains can interact specifically with acetylated lysine [3].Domain

PF00240Ubiquitin family (ubiquitin)Ubiquitin familyThis family contains a number of ubiquitin-like proteins: SUMO (smt3 homologue) (see Swiss:Q02724), Nedd8 (see Swiss:P29595), Elongin B (see Swiss:Q15370), Rub1 (see Swiss:Q9SHE7), and Parkin (see Swiss:O60260). A number of them are thought to carry a distinctive five-residue motif termed the proteasome-interacting motif (PIM), which may have a biologically significant role in protein delivery to proteasomes and recruitment of proteasomes to transcription sites [5].

PF01847VHL beta domain (VHL)VHL beta domainVHL forms a ternary complex with the elonginB Swiss:O44226 and elonginC Swiss:O13292 proteins. This complex binds Cul2, which then is involved in regulation of vascular endothelial growth factor Swiss:P15692 mRNA.Domain
